在 Firefox Developer Edition 的调试器中,我设置了一个断点来定位 JavaScript 变量的赋值。我希望能够将鼠标悬停在所有先前定义的变量上,以在工具提示中查看它们的值,就像以前版本的 Firefox 一样,但它没有向我显示任何内容,而且似乎没有一个可以添加到侧面的窗口:
关于如何显示变量值有什么想法吗?
所以我有一个模拟(typemoq)http调用,我将其传递到我的react组件(安装了酶)中:
const mockhttp: TypeMoq.IMock<IHttpRequest> = TypeMoq.Mock.ofType<IHttpRequest>();
mockhttp
.setup(x => x.get('/get-all-goal-questions'))
.returns(() => {
return Promise.resolve(mockResponse.object.data);
});
const wrapper = mount(<Goals history={Object} http={mockhttp.object} />);
expect(wrapper.find('#foo')).to.have.lengthOf(1);
Run Code Online (Sandbox Code Playgroud)
但是,直到“期望”之后才调用模拟“ Get”,如何才能获得期望,直到调用该模拟进行测试?
//编辑这里是测试代码
let httpCall = this.props.pageHoc.httpRequest -- the call im mocking
Run Code Online (Sandbox Code Playgroud)
let httpCall = this.props.pageHoc.httpRequest -- the call im mocking
Run Code Online (Sandbox Code Playgroud)
我从官方文档中了解了反应高阶组件示例,但如果可能的话,我想使用稍微不同的 props.children - 即
<PageHoc> // Higher order component
<Route exact path="/" component={Invite} /> // I want to auto inject props here
</PageHoc>
Run Code Online (Sandbox Code Playgroud)
在我的页面 HOC 中,我可以自动渲染子组件,但如何在此处附加一些新的道具?
import React from 'react';
class PageHoc extends React.Component {
constructor(props) {
super(props);
}
render() {
return this.props.children
}
}
export default PageHoc;
Run Code Online (Sandbox Code Playgroud)
我在 json 中有 html,它已经被编码(通过 c#)到:
{"itemID":6,"GlossaryWord":"ante","GlossaryDescription":"\u003cp\u003e\r\n\t\u003cstrong\u003eUp the ante\u0026nbsp;\u003c/strong\u003e\u003c/p\u003e\r\n\u003cul\u003e\r\n\t\u003cli\u003e\r\n\t\t\u003cstrong\u003eHere\u003c/strong\u003e\u003c/li\u003e\r\n\t\u003cli\u003e\r\n\t\t\u003cstrong\u003eis\u0026nbsp;\u003c/strong\u003e\u003c/li\u003e\r\n\t\u003cli\u003e\r\n\t\t\u003cb\u003esomething\u003c/b\u003e\u003c/li\u003e\r\n\u003c/ul\u003e\r\n","CategoryID":6}
Run Code Online (Sandbox Code Playgroud)
But how would I decode GlossaryDescription in JavaScript/AngularJS so that it displays the html tags like <p>
& <strong>
etc? Thanks as always :)
所以我理解了API的基本原理,让我能够访问系统的核心数据和功能 - 在这种情况下是Kentico.例如,我想从"CMS_Membership"数据库表中获取所有数据,因此我从https://devnet.kentico.com/docs/8_2/api/html/N_CMS_Membership.htm开始,有数百个不同的类和功能 - 我尝试了一些看起来像他们可能会回归我想要但没有快乐的东西.
你是否真的使用和API寻找一个听起来像你想要的方法名称?我听说过kentico中的"提供者",这些是更简单的方法来执行常见功能吗?最后我只是写了一个SQL查询直接到表,我知道这可能是错的.